Overview

The Logitech Zone Wired Headset is a professional-grade headset designed to enhance communication in remote work and office environments. This wired headset offers seamless compatibility with major platforms such as Microsoft Teams, Zoom, and Skype for Business. The noise-canceling microphone ensures crystal-clear audio even in open office spaces. Additionally, the included USB-C connector, along with a USB-A adapter, provides flexible connectivity for various devices, making it ideal for professionals on the go. Overall, this headset blends comfort and functionality, delivering high-quality performance in any professional setting.

Features & Benefits

This Logitech headset boasts advanced dual noise-canceling microphones that improve call clarity by isolating your voice from background noise. The 40mm audio drivers deliver rich sound quality, making it ideal for both conference calls and casual music listening. For long hours of wear, the memory-foam ear pads and adjustable headband provide optimal comfort. Inline controls make it easy to manage volume, mute, and call functions without interrupting your workflow. The Logi Tune app also allows you to fine-tune audio settings for a fully customized experience, ensuring perfect sound quality.

Specifications

  • Headset Type: This is a wired headset designed for professional use and remote work.
  • Microphone: The headset features a dual noise-canceling microphone for clear voice communication.
  • Connectivity: It connects via USB-C with an included USB-A adapter for broad device compatibility.
  • Audio Drivers: The 40mm drivers provide high-quality audio for both calls and music.
  • Sound Quality: The headset delivers wideband sound, ensuring clear and natural audio during calls.
  • Frequency Range: It supports a frequency range of 20Hz–16kHz, suitable for professional and personal audio needs.
  • Compatibility: The headset is compatible with Windows, Mac, and Chrome OS, making it versatile for various platforms.
  • Certifications: Certified for Microsoft Teams and Skype for Business for reliable use with these platforms.
  • Inline Controls: Inline controls for volume, mute, and call management are built directly into the headset for easy operation.
  • Cable Length: The headset features a 6.2 ft (1.9 m) cable, offering flexibility for desk or workstation setups.
  • Comfort Features: Memory-foam ear pads and an adjustable headband provide comfort for long periods of use.
